首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ular 2通过服务更改页面标题

Angular 2是一种流行的前端开发框架,它通过服务来更改页面标题。在Angular 2中,可以使用Angular的内置服务Title来更改页面的标题。

Title服务是Angular的核心模块@angular/platform-browser中的一部分。要使用Title服务,首先需要在组件中导入它:

代码语言:txt
复制
import { Title } from '@angular/platform-browser';

然后,在组件的构造函数中注入Title服务:

代码语言:txt
复制
constructor(private titleService: Title) { }

接下来,可以使用setTitle方法来更改页面的标题:

代码语言:txt
复制
this.titleService.setTitle('新的页面标题');

通过调用setTitle方法并传入新的页面标题作为参数,就可以动态地更改页面的标题。

Angular 2中通过服务更改页面标题的优势是可以在不同的组件中共享和重用该服务。这意味着可以在应用程序的不同部分中使用相同的服务来更改页面标题,而不需要重复编写相同的代码。

Angular 2中通过服务更改页面标题的应用场景包括但不限于以下几种情况:

  • 在单页应用程序中,根据用户的操作动态更改页面标题,以提供更好的用户体验。
  • 在多语言应用程序中,根据用户选择的语言动态更改页面标题,以适应不同的语言环境。
  • 在需要根据不同的路由或页面内容更改页面标题的应用程序中,使用服务可以更方便地管理和更新页面标题。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。虽然不能直接提及腾讯云的产品链接,但可以通过访问腾讯云官方网站来了解更多关于这些产品的信息和文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

17分38秒

2.尚硅谷全套JAVA教程--微服务核心(46.39GB)/尚硅谷2023最新版spring6课程/视频/80-尚硅谷-Spring6框架-数据校验:Validation-通过Validator接口实现.mp4

26分48秒

319、商城业务-秒杀服务-秒杀页面渲染

14分22秒

324、商城业务-秒杀服务-秒杀页面完成

11分39秒

173、商城业务-检索服务-搭建页面环境

20分33秒

230、商城业务-认证服务-页面效果完成

17分24秒

261、商城业务-订单服务-页面环境搭建

8分58秒

174、商城业务-检索服务-调整页面跳转

14分10秒

185、商城业务-检索服务-页面筛选条件渲染

22分27秒

187、商城业务-检索服务-页面排序功能

20分56秒

184、商城业务-检索服务-页面基本数据渲染

21分48秒

186、商城业务-检索服务-页面分页数据渲染

21分23秒

188、商城业务-检索服务-页面排序字段回显

领券